The Verdict

Seasonal promotions can yield significant advantages, but they require a meticulous approach to evaluate their actual worth. The key is to analyze the terms attached to these bonuses to ensure they align with your gaming strategy.

The Good

  • Enhanced RTP: Seasonal promotions often come with bonuses that can enhance your effective RTP. For example, a standard slot with a 96% RTP might effectively offer a 98% RTP when combined with a 20% bonus on deposits.
  • Free Spins: Many promotions feature free spins on selected games. This allows players to try new titles without risking their own bankroll. A common offer might be 50 free spins with a wagering requirement of 35x on winnings.
  • Exclusive Events: Seasonal promotions often tie into special events, providing exclusive access to tournaments or limited-time games, which can be lucrative if you have a solid strategy in place.

The Bad

  • Wagering Requirements: Many promotions come with steep wagering requirements, often around 35x to 50x. This means if you receive a $100 bonus, you must wager between $3,500 and $5,000 before you can withdraw any winnings.
  • Game Restrictions: Certain promotions may limit which games your bonus can be used on, often excluding high RTP games. This can undermine the potential value of the offer.
  • Time Constraints: Seasonal promotions typically have expiration dates, which can pressure players to meet wagering requirements quickly, potentially leading to poor decisions.

The Ugly

  • Hidden Terms: Often, the fine print can hide unfavorable terms. For instance, a promotion might state “up to 100% bonus” but come with a clause that significantly restricts its use, making it less appealing.
  • Low Cap on Winnings: Some bonuses may cap the maximum winnings, limiting the potential return on a successful wager. For instance, a $100 bonus might only allow a maximum cash-out of $200.
  • Poor Game Selection: Seasonal promotions might be tied to games with a low RTP, diminishing the overall value of the offer. Always check the RTP of games involved before diving in.
